首页
/ Electron预编译版教程

Electron预编译版教程

2026-01-18 10:09:54作者:温艾琴Wonderful

项目介绍

Electron预编编译(electron-prebuilt) 是一个便捷的Electron版本分发方式,它允许开发者无需手动编译Electron源码即可直接下载并运行对应平台的Electron二进制文件。这一项目极大地简化了Electron应用程序的开发启动流程,使得开发者可以迅速搭建基于Node.js和Chromium的跨平台桌面应用环境。

项目快速启动

要快速启动一个基于Electron预编译版的应用,首先确保你的系统上安装了 Node.js。然后,按照以下步骤进行:

# 使用npm全局安装electron-prebuilt
npm install -g electron-prebuilt

# 运行Electron(默认打开一个空的窗口)
electron

如果你想在你的项目中使用特定版本的Electron,可以通过在项目目录下执行以下命令来局部安装特定版本:

npm install --save-dev electron-prebuilt@版本号

之后,在你的项目脚本中调用electron命令,或者通过Node.js script来启动应用。

应用案例和最佳实践

Electron被广泛用于构建各类桌面应用程序,从简单的个人工具到复杂的企业级应用不等。一个著名的应用案例是Visual Studio Code,它利用Electron的强大能力提供了丰富的代码编辑功能和跨平台支持。

最佳实践

  1. 分离主进程和渲染进程: 主进程管理应用程序生命周期,渲染进程处理UI。这有助于保持代码的清晰和可维护性。

  2. 使用环境变量管理不同环境配置: 开发、测试和生产环境应有不同的设置。

  3. 性能优化: 注意内存管理和CPU使用,避免在渲染进程中执行耗时操作。

  4. 安全意识: 由于Electron基于Node.js和Chromium,需注意JavaScript沙箱环境外的安全问题。

典型生态项目

Electron的生态系统丰富多样,包括但不限于:

  • Electron Forge: 一个强大的初始化、构建、打包、发布和更新Electron应用的工具集。

  • Vue.js Electron: 结合Vue.js框架简化Electron应用开发,提供了一套完整的模板和脚手架。

  • React Electron Boilerplate: 专为React爱好者设计的起点,快速开始基于React的Electron开发。

这些项目进一步降低了Electron应用的开发门槛,让开发者能够更加专注于业务逻辑的实现,而不是基础设施的搭建。


以上就是关于Electron预编译版的基本介绍、快速启动指南、应用案例及最佳实践概述,以及一些典型的生态系统项目推荐。希望这些内容对你的Electron开发之旅有所帮助。

登录后查看全文
热门项目推荐
相关项目推荐